Jayco van – Good van for travel and we are building so it’s been home for a while Windows cracking I feel it’s a problem caused by the blinds they are silver on the window face heat builds up it’s reflected back into the double glazed window and bang it cracks, solution just use your drapes not the blind ! Very good value, after 8 weeks of vanning, we are still happy with purchase decision but – Waste water drainage poor, the design of same is worrying, the issue is masked for those that have a grey water tank. Simple but not inexpensive to rectify. Large kitchen draws fall out in transit, the draw slides are the cheapest available. Why oh why. The Window click clack struts are so light [like pre stressed comalco alfoil], we had failures… Read more
where they lock out full extended and will not go in. Fancy LED outside light on roll out looks good but with only one external light on van wall, cooking after dark using the drop down table is a dim affair. Many of the external storage spaces/ boxes etc and the tunnel boot [that is mostly inaccessible] are simply impractical. The instant hot water [Gas] is great for long showerers, but wastes a significant amount of water before it gets warm, free campers would need to catch that water lest they runout [ 5-10 litres every time]. It also means a modest increase in operating costs for Gas. We have had the large side door on slide out draw come open numerous times in transit causing damage. [in spite of using rubber wedges to secure]. Ensuite door securing padbolt fails to stayed located, door comes open and will cause damage unless secured by other means, simple fix but how such an oversight occurred surprises. Jayco are silent on the need for vertical support poles for the roll out awning and do not supply any, if/when heavy Annexe side used, the stress would I expect cause damage to the mechanism/ bracing on van side wall.
